Written just prior to the demonstrations of 1968, Lefebvre's manifesto-essay is "a cry and a demand" for the right to the city. In a series of sketches, the essay condemns what the author sees as the alienating conditions of modern urban life, embodied by rational planning and new towns, and calls for a city that is a collective work emerging from interaction and creative acts by the ...

Henri Lefebvre has extended Marx's analysis of production relations in the social division of labor to consumption and the reproduction of the relations of production by incorporating cultural processes as well as relations of domination and subordination that are not reduced to the mode of production as orthodox Marxists do. [space] was more often synonymous with What Is The Right to the City? | RioOnWatch The concept was first developed by French sociologist Henri Lefebvre in his 1968 book Le droit à la ville. He defines the Right to the city as a right of no exclusion of urban society from qualities and benefits of urban life. In the text Lefebvre writes about socio-economic segregation and its phenomenon of estrangement.
